Does Wise Work In Dominican Republic?

Does Wise work in the Dominican Republic? Based on the information available, Wise does not operate in the Dominican Republic. The country is not listed among the supported regions for sending or receiving money through Wise.
As a result, users in the Dominican Republic cannot access Wise's services, including international money transfers, multi-currency accounts, or the Wise debit card. This limitation means that residents and businesses in the Dominican Republic will need to explore alternative financial services for their international transactions.
